A stag and doe stand quietly beneath blossoming chrysanthemums and maple leaves, framed by vivid bands of orange and green that glow against the white porcelain background. The scene evokes both autumn tranquility and the enduring beauty of Japanese artistry. Each element is rendered in delicate overglaze enamel, with fine brushwork revealing subtle shading and expressive detail. The cylindrical form is bordered by a classic geometric fret pattern at the rim, a nod to traditional Imari and Kutani aesthetics.
